They spend a lot of time when out either on me at the dining room table visiting, my bedroom window or napping on my bed. The windows are very low in this house handicap accessibility & safety is rather easy to accomplish. This seems to be the favorite spot for many of my beardies. I don't like them roaming in the living room there are to many girls in view and they are easily worked up...if you know what I mean. :lol: Roux is in my bedroom but her viv sits high so they don't really see her. Well they didn't last Summer when she was little. I can't say it will still be this way this Spring and Summer now she's grown. Zak-n-Wheezie like mostly to go for rides and walks in the outdoors. :D

Zak-n-Wheezie's ability to change colors so dramatically I find very interesting. They usually are colored like Rocky their daddy(a rock), but when they get fired up or happy their color is so much like Peaches their mommy's(yellow, orange highlights) that they don't even look like the same beardies to me sometimes. :lol: I even have to giggle sometimes when I post the pic's of them fired up...wondering if anyone thinks I doctored up the pic. :lol:
